In the course of their stellar evolution, some stars pass through phases where they could become pulsating variables. Pulsating variable stars fluctuate in radius and luminosity after a while, expanding and contracting with intervals ranging from minutes to years, depending on the dimension on the star. This class involves Cepheid and Cepheid-like stars, and very long-period of time variables for instance Mira.[196]

White Dwarfs As soon as a purple big has ejected The whole lot of its environment, just a dim ball of Power remains at its core, often called a white dwarf. A white dwarf is typically in regards to the dimensions of Earth but with many hundreds of A huge number of moments extra mass. After a star is during the white dwarf phase, it only cools and now not creates new heat. White dwarfs can range in color from blueish-white tones to red. Neutron Stars A neutron star occurs every time a higher-mass star runs from fuel and collapses ahead of rebounding and triggering an enormous explosion or supernova. The dense remnants from the star’s core once the supernova are often called neutron stars. Neutron stars are way too dim to find out by eye inside the night sky, although the Hubble Telescope has captured a number of photographs.
